What is the difference between Controller Search vs Financial Analyst?
| Aspect | Controller | Financial Analyst |
|---|---|---|
| Required Credentials | CPA or CMA often preferred | Bachelor's degree in finance, accounting, or related field |
| Work Environment | Corporate finance, accounting departments | Finance departments, investment firms, corporate offices |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Used in manufacturing, retail, and large corporations | Common in banking, investment, and corporate sectors |
| Search & Comparison Intent | Focus on financial management, internal controls | Focus on financial analysis, reporting, forecasting |
While Controllers oversee financial reporting and internal controls, Financial Analysts focus on analyzing financial data to support decision-making. Both roles are essential in finance but differ in responsibilities and skill sets.

BANFIELD PET HOSPITAL
AREA CHIEF OF STAFF - Veterinarian
SUMMARY OF JOB PURPOSE AND FUNCTION
The primary purpose and function of the Area Chief of Staff is to lead, develop and manage associate veterinarians in their hospitals to ensure Banfield can attract, develop, engage and retain doctors that will deliver quality care and meet expected hospital performance measures. This position drives the culture and delivery of quality care by the veterinary provider team (DVM, CVT, VA) in their assigned hospitals to ensure that every pet receives consistent care aligning with our six domains of quality (safe, effective, patient/client centered, timely, efficient and equitable care.) The Area Chief of Staff partners with the Practice Manager (if applicable) to drive the culture and delivery of quality care by the veterinary provider team (DVM, CVT, VA) in their assigned hospitals to ensure that every pet receives consistent care aligning with our six domains of quality (safe, effective, patient/client centered, timely, efficient and equitable care.
ESSENTIAL RESPONSIBILITIES AND TASKS
· Live and exemplify the Five Principles of Mars, Inc. within self and team.
· Act as Responsible Veterinarian for Veterinary and Pharmacy Board Permits, as required by federal, state, or local law. Responsible for the ownership and management of the controlled substance inventory for relief doctors.
· Own doctor engagement and retention by consistently assessing risk, ensuring a proactive retention strategy, and creating a culture of community and engagement where doctors feel supported and can be successful.
· Provide effective medical leadership to their hospital teams by driving an inclusive and collaborative work environment in their assigned hospitals in partnership with the practice managers.
· Validate the clinical skillset and alignment with quality standards of doctors, veterinary assistants, and veterinary technicians by performing medical record reviews, veterinary quality assignments, audits and patient safety event reviews in their assigned hospitals.
· Provide veterinary services. The amount of time spent in clinical role, seeing patients, will depend on various factors. These include the numbers of hospitals, number of direct reports, the productivity and performance of each hospital. All ACOS should expect to spend a percentage of their time in role, and this will be aligned upon a case-by-case basis in partnership with the DVQ. This role is 100% hospital based and considered a working manager role.
· Oversee the coaching program for newly hired veterinarians to ensure an engaging experience which results in a productive doctor knowledgeable in Banfield quality standards, Optimum Wellness Plans, processes, and workflows. Ensure experiential learning to develop clinical, surgical, and dental skills based on individual veterinarian needs.
· Partner with the Director of Veterinary Quality and Talent Acquisition team to recruit veterinary talent. Act as a brand ambassador in the local veterinary community. Deliver an excellent hospital experience to student externs, student job program participants, and veterinary candidates during hospital observations.
· Work with associate doctors to ensure they have the skills to achieve their productivity goals through delivery of high-quality medicine, a focus on preventive care, providing a great client experience, and partnership with the hospital team.
· Deliver veterinary operations KPI's of assigned hospitals through their leadership of the hospital and their partnership with the practice managers. Partner with practice manager to develop, execute, and revise plans which achieve targeted KPI's through hospital performance. Accountable to hospital OGSM performance as quality medicine delivers operational outcomes.
· Develop a veterinary leadership talent bench and have a succession plan in place for assigned hospital pod.
· Ensure compliance to Banfield's clinical essentials, government regulations and legislation, and veterinary industry standards through veterinary quality assessments, medical record reviews, audits, and patient safety event reviews. Hospital operations must meet all local, state and federal regulatory requirements including but not limited to compliance with controlled substance management and radiation safety. Create and execute timely plans to resolve identified gaps.
· Champion preventive care culture by communicating, demonstrating, and validating behaviors which drive optimum wellness plan growth and retention.
· Create a say yes culture by driving access to care and superior client service resulting in meeting or exceeding client experience scorecard goals. Responsible for the appropriate and timely resolution of client complaints related to medical standard of care.
· Manage the medical equipment inventory and new medical equipment requests in partnership with their Director of Veterinary Quality in their assigned hospitals.
· Deliver the highest level of veterinary care to every pet in a professional and ethical manner while ensuring that the client and their pet have an exceptional experience.
· Establish trust and gain the confidence and compliance of clients through effectively delivering appropriate preventive care, performing complete diagnostic workups, developing thorough treatment plans, communicating home care instructions, and planning follow-up visits.
· Other job duties as assigned.

About Banfield Pet Hospital
Sourced by ZipRecruiter
Banfield Pet Hospital was founded in 1955 and is currently located in Vancouver, WA, US. A leader within the pet healthcare industry, it specializes in providing comprehensive preventive and medical services to pets. Operating more than 1,000 hospitals across the United States and Puerto Rico, Banfield's commitment to top-class care is reflected in its mission - "To treat your pet like family, and you like our own." At the core of Banfield's mission is the belief in quality veterinary care and fostering an environment that promotes responsible pet ownership. The company established the Banfield Foundation in 2015 to further emphasize their commitment to pets, which has since then provided over $8 million in grants to projects that enhance the wellbeing of pets.
